What’s Included in Your Tour
Luxury transportation isn’t the only perk of the Private Night-Time Tour of Washington DC; the experience is packed with a variety of inclusions that enhance the journey.
Guests enjoy private transportation in a spacious SUV, complete with bottled water to stay refreshed. All fees and taxes are covered, so no surprise costs pop up later.
Plus, the tour isn’t just about the sights—it’s tailored to your group’s preferences. With free cancellation up to 24 hours before, you can plan with peace of mind.

Pricing and Reservation Details
When it comes to enjoying a Private Night-Time Tour of Washington DC, the pricing is surprisingly reasonable for such a unique experience.
Starting at just $467.10 for a group of up to six, you can snag a fantastic deal—originally priced at $519. With a Lowest Price Guarantee and the option to reserve now and pay later, flexibility is key.
Plus, you’ll enjoy free pickup and drop-off within 15 miles! Just confirm your start time with the local provider.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can We Bring Our Own Food or Drinks on the Tour?
They can’t bring their own food or drinks on the tour, but they’ll enjoy complimentary bottled water. It’s all about the sights and comfort, so everyone can focus on creating unforgettable memories together.
Are There Restrooms Available During the Tour?
During the tour, restrooms aren’t available at every stop, but the guides often plan breaks at convenient locations. They ensure everyone’s comfortable and can easily accommodate restroom needs as the journey unfolds.
What Happens in Case of Bad Weather?
If bad weather hits, they’ll quickly reach out to reschedule or provide a refund. They prioritize safety and comfort, ensuring everyone has an enjoyable experience, rain or shine, without missing out on the sights.
Is the Tour Suitable for Children?
The tour’s perfect for kids! It offers a fun, family-friendly experience with spacious transportation and engaging guides. Plus, the stunning monuments at night will surely captivate their imagination while making lasting memories together.
How Long Does the Tour Typically Last?
The tour typically lasts around three hours, giving guests plenty of time to soak in the sights. They’ll enjoy the illuminated landmarks and personalized experiences, ensuring a memorable evening without feeling rushed.
